Ticket #— Floor 9 Opening Prep, Brindlemoor House

Hi facilities folks, Floor 9 opens to staff next Monday and we need a few things squared away before then. Lift access is live, but the two side doors by the kitchenette are still on the old lock config — please reprogram them before Friday. Also, signage for the quiet rooms hasn't arrived, so pop up the temporary printed ones for now. Until the badge readers sync, the interim door code for Floor 9 is below.

door code, bajop-bajog: bdg-DSWAC-43621

Key ceremony checklist — item 7, for plugin authors: before your CSV import wizard plugin can sign manifests for Tablemint, join the ceremony call, confirm your fingerprint matches the roster, and countersign the ledger. Quick heads-up: the signing enclave stays sealed until someone enters the recovery passphrase, which you'll find right below.

strongbox words: sorir-belvan-rusix-ulays-ralmir-praix-eliir-tamax-praael-druael-julir-tamius-jorir

### PR: Tame layout thrash in Graphwick's force simulation

This change addresses the jitter we saw in last week's demo when rendering the Pellman repo's 4k-node graph. The simulator now freezes nodes whose displacement falls below a threshold, and edge bundling is deferred until the layout stabilizes. Render time on the benchmark corpus dropped from 9.2s to 3.1s with no visible quality loss. No API changes; the viewer in Lanternfell consumes the same payload. Tuning knobs introduced by this PR are listed below.

tuning constants:
RATE_LIMITS = {
    "ralwyn": 2,
    "druath": 10,
    "ralix": 1,
    "quenath": 10,
}

## Releases

Lattice ships with permessage-deflate off by default. Compression saves ~60% bandwidth on chatty feeds but costs CPU and memory per socket — at Fennick-scale connection counts, that matters. Enable it only for low-concurrency deployments. Benchmarks live in perf/ws-compress. Release cadence: biweekly, tagged from main, artifacts built by the Brindle runner. Every release tarball must be verified against the signing key below.

release key, hadug-kawef: bky13_mPGeFZeR1GZ1G